Handover: SQL lint rules for Petrel

I've finished tightening the Petrel SQL linter rules — naming checks are now errors, and the join-style rule was demoted to a warning after feedback. Tests cover every rule transition. Please review the diffs against the active config, reproduced here for convenience:

deployment values, fahap-hahaf:
[casdor]
port = 9200
region = south-2
host = casdor.qirvanworks.corp
timeout_ms = 3000
retries = 4

Capacity note for the Skylark string-extraction script: the full run over all app bundles takes roughly 40 minutes on one worker and scales near-linearly to four, after which repo checkout becomes the bottleneck. Memory peaks during the dedupe pass, so don't co-schedule it with the build. For the release cut, run it the night before. The limits we settled on are set below.

tuning table, yajog-yahof:
BUDGETS = {
    "lamvan": 303,
    "wenox": 460,
    "fenvan": 525,
}

The user module is being extracted from the Kestrelbase monolith into the standalone Fernloop identity service. Session issuance, password reset, and profile reads now route through Fernloop's internal gateway; the monolith retains only a thin proxy for legacy callers. All traffic is mTLS within the Quarrow mesh. Rate limits are enforced per caller, not per user. Requests to the migration endpoint must authenticate with the internal key shown below.

service key, tadup-tahog: zpat7_wB1tnEL

The renewal of our three-year agreement with Torvane Materials has been assessed in detail. Proposed terms include a 4.2% unit-price increase, partially offset by improved volume rebates and extended payment terms of sixty days. Sensitivity analysis indicates a net annual cost impact of under 1% on the Meridia product line, assuming stable demand. Legal has flagged no material changes to liability clauses. We recommend approval, subject to the conditions outlined in the confidential note below.

confidential, yawip-bahif: Zorokox Partners plans to lower the Casax list price by 28.0 percent in April. The board signed off on a budget of $271.0 million for Project Juldor. The renewal with Pelokox Partners closes at $410.1 million a year, 3.4 percent below the last contract. Project Pelok slips by a full year because of the audit delay.